Remarks

The college is average because placements are not that good.

Course Curriculum Overview

I am working in PwC in taxation field our college teaches accounts and taxation very well which helped me to grab a good job in big four audit firm and I am still working there so I take this opportunity to thank my teachers and non teaching facalty as well.

Placement Experience

3

Placements are not that good in our college most of the companies are bpo companies which offers bpo jobs.

College Events

4

Freshers day, annual day farewell days cultural days we compete with other colleges as well for certain festivals and they are very big from the rest of the colleges our college celebrates freshers day in a grand fashion by welcoming chief guests from different fields.

Fee Structure And Facilities

Feasible as this helps for an over all development of the student no additional fees will be paid by the student the mode of payment accepted by the college is cash yes they provide transperency in fee break down fee wise our college is very good and feasible.

Fees and Financial Aid

Yes they offer scholarships to the students who get good marks in your intermediate exams and your tenth class public exam.

Campus Life

They are no gender issues in our college and when comes to extra curicular activities they used to conduct quiz and debate competition in our college we used to have lots of fun and the winners will be awarded wit prices and we used to conduct workshops on recent scams happening in the society.

Hostel Facilities

No idea about hostels I never opted for hostel but I came to know from one of my friends that hostel facility in our college are not that good food and other facilities in our college is also not that good.

Alumni/Alumna

Yes the alumni network and senior students were very helpful in all the ways to me by providing knowledge as well as fun to me.

Admission

Based on the merit list there will be a formal interview and you will be selected good course and best facality good atmosphere best library facility the college is not that far from my house scope of the course I took was large like I can get into accounts taxation finance and many other fields.

Faculty

5

They are well qualified I can give on 9 of 10 there are 40 lecturers and the average age is 30 above and I also saw a person who studied in our college and became a lecturer yes they hold releavant industry experience and expertise in the area they teach.
